Is the use of Glinorm 1 Tablet safe for pregnant women?
Glinorm may have some side effects during pregnancy. Pregnant women should discontinue the use of Glinorm, and talk to their doctor, if they notice any discomfort.
Is the use of Glinorm 1 Tablet safe during breastfeeding?
There is no research available on the side effects of Glinorm in breastfeeding women. Therefore, its impact is unknown.
What is the effect of Glinorm 1 Tablet on the Kidneys?
There may be some adverse effects on kidney after taking Glinorm. If you observe any such side effects, stop taking this drug. Consume this medicine again only if your doctor advises you to do so.
What is the effect of Glinorm 1 Tablet on the Liver?
There may be an adverse effect on the liver after taking Glinorm. If you observe any side effects on your body then stop taking this drug. Take this medicine again only if your doctor advises you to do so.
What is the effect of Glinorm 1 Tablet on the Heart?
Side effects of Glinorm rarely affect the heart.
